Understanding Solar Panel Electricity Generation

Conventional photovoltaic (PV) panels typically produce 250-400 watts under standard test conditions. But real-world output depends on three key factors:

  • Sunlight intensity: Arizona vs. Scotland? That's a 60% difference!
  • Panel orientation: A 30° tilt can boost output by 15% compared to flat installation
  • System efficiency: Modern inverters now achieve 97-98% conversion rates

"A typical 6kW residential system in California generates about 9,000 kWh annually – enough to power an energy-efficient 3-bedroom home." - NREL 2023 Solar Report

5 Factors That Make or Break Your Solar Output

Want to squeeze every watt from your panels? Watch these variables:

  1. Peak Sun Hours: Phoenix gets 6.5 vs. London's 2.8 daily average
  2. Temperature Coefficients: Output drops 0.3-0.5% per °C above 25°C
  3. Shading: Just 10% shade can cut production by 50%!

Maximizing Your Solar Investment

Pro tips from industry experts:

  • Combine east-west orientations for 15% longer daily production
  • Use microinverters to mitigate shading issues
  • Implement bi-facial panels in snowy regions (18% output boost)

FAQ: Solar Power Generation

How many panels power a home?

Most homes need 15-25 panels (6-10kW system), depending on energy consumption and location.
